53% public across 429,779 ac. Real backcountry here — 35% of the public land sits more than a mile from any road. Watch the checkerboard: 781 ac of public land has no public route in.

Land & access

USFS 40%BLM 10%SFW 3%□ Private 47%
Unit area429,779 ac
Public land228,745 ac (53%)
Landlocked public781 ac (0.3%)
Motorized routes (MVUM + roads)908 mi
Maintained trails440 mi

Backcountry

Public land >1 mi from a road80,754 ac (35% of public)
Road density1.35 mi/mi²
Managed byUSFS 174k ac · BLM 43k ac · SFW 11k ac

How these numbers are made

public_land_pct = public_area / unit_area
landlocked = public ∖ reachable(roads, corners)
remote = public ∖ buffer(roads, 1 mi)
